One in Custody in $180K ORC Jewelry Heist; Police Seek Two Others

Lancaster police are investigating an organized theft ring accused of stealing more than $180,000 worth of jewelry during a New Year’s Day heist at the Park City Center.

Police said one of the men involved is in custody, but they are still looking for the people who worked with him. Duanne Pierce, 56, of Philadelphia, and two others went into the Kay Jewelers store on January 1, police said.

While Pierce’s accomplices distracted the workers, police said, he entered an employee-only area and stole layaway items. Pierce also took a key and used it to access the Leo Diamond case, according to police. Police said the items taken were worth $187,529.62… WGAL8 News
